随着互联网技术的不断发展,网页的加载速度和用户体验已成为网站性能优化的关键。尤其是在91网页版这类社交平台和内容聚合网站中,如何提高用户的互动体验、减少加载等待时间,已成为开发者面临的重要课题。而其中,视觉回流、页面跳转、历史记录管理与预加载策略的合理运用,正是提升网页性能和优化用户体验的重要手段。

91网页版视觉回流研究:页面跳转、历史记录与预加载策略,91视角是啥

什么是视觉回流?

在网页开发中,视觉回流(Reflow)指的是当页面内容发生变化时,浏览器重新计算元素的尺寸和位置,从而导致页面布局重新渲染的过程。这个过程通常是耗时且资源密集型的,尤其在页面包含大量元素和复杂布局时,回流会严重影响页面的响应速度和流畅度。每次触发回流都会消耗大量的计算资源,并且可能会导致页面的“卡顿”现象。

在91网页版这种内容丰富、功能复杂的页面中,频繁的视觉回流可能会影响用户浏览的流畅性和互动体验。为了减少视觉回流的发生,开发者需要对页面的渲染过程和元素变化进行精确控制。

页面跳转的优化

页面跳转是用户浏览网页时常见的交互行为,尤其在91网页版中,页面内容经常需要在不同模块之间跳转和切换。当用户点击链接、按钮或执行其他动作时,浏览器会进行页面跳转,加载新内容或显示新的页面。

传统的页面跳转通常需要重新加载整个页面,这不仅增加了加载时间,还可能导致用户体验的下降。为了优化这一点,现代的网页开发通常采用“单页面应用”(SPA)模式,利用JavaScript控制页面内容的动态加载。通过SPA模式,只有需要更新的部分会被重新加载,从而避免了整个页面的刷新,减少了页面跳转带来的等待时间。

在91网页版中,使用动态页面加载技术能够在用户点击链接后,快速切换不同的页面内容,同时减少了视觉回流现象的出现。通过这种方式,用户可以更加流畅地浏览页面,且不受页面跳转的延迟影响。

历史记录管理与视觉回流

历史记录是浏览器的重要功能之一,它记录了用户访问过的网页链接。当用户点击浏览器的“返回”或“前进”按钮时,历史记录功能能够帮助用户快速跳转到之前浏览过的页面。在复杂的网页应用中,历史记录的管理可能会与页面的渲染过程产生冲突,导致不必要的视觉回流。

91网页版中的页面跳转通常会涉及到历史记录的操作。例如,当用户在社交平台中浏览不同的聊天对话时,历史记录功能会记录下用户的每次操作。为了减少回流的发生,开发者需要在设计历史记录功能时,确保只有在必要时才触发页面渲染,而不是每次历史记录变化时都重新计算页面布局。

预加载策略的应用

91网页版视觉回流研究:页面跳转、历史记录与预加载策略,91视角是啥

在91网页版中,预加载策略是一项非常有效的优化手段。通过预加载,浏览器可以在用户访问页面之前,提前加载一些必要的资源,确保页面能够更快速地响应用户的操作。预加载不仅能够减少加载等待时间,还能有效地避免在页面跳转过程中出现卡顿或视觉回流的问题。

预加载策略的实现通常通过JavaScript实现资源的提前加载。例如,在用户进入某个页面之前,预加载该页面所需的图片、视频和其他静态资源。这样,当用户真正需要访问页面时,所有资源已经被加载并准备就绪,浏览器能够即时呈现页面内容,而不会出现因资源未加载完全导致的等待时间和回流现象。

在91网页版中,合理运用预加载策略能够大大提升用户的浏览体验,尤其是在需要快速跳转和展示多种内容的场景中,能够有效减少页面加载的延迟。

视觉回流的减少与页面优化

为了进一步减少视觉回流,开发者需要对页面的布局和样式进行优化。避免使用会触发回流的CSS属性,例如“width”、“height”和“top”这样的属性,尤其在元素位置或大小变化频繁时,尽量避免使用它们。通过避免频繁修改DOM元素的样式,可以降低回流发生的频率。

合理使用CSS3动画和过渡效果,而不是使用JavaScript来进行动画处理,也能够减少视觉回流的影响。CSS3动画通常比JavaScript动画更加高效,因为它们是由浏览器本身的渲染引擎处理的,不会频繁地触发回流或重绘。

91网页版的优化可以从设计阶段就开始,减少不必要的DOM元素和复杂的布局结构,使得浏览器能够更加高效地渲染页面。开发者还可以通过工具进行性能分析,找到页面中哪些部分最容易导致视觉回流,从而加以优化。

动态内容加载与用户体验

91网页版作为一个互动性强的平台,页面中的内容经常需要动态加载。例如,当用户在浏览时,平台可能会根据用户的兴趣推荐新的内容,或在聊天过程中加载更多的消息。这些动态加载的内容如果处理不当,也可能导致视觉回流或页面闪烁。

为了解决这个问题,动态内容的加载需要与页面的渲染过程进行有效的协调。一个常见的解决方案是使用“懒加载”技术,即在用户滚动页面时,只有当内容即将出现在可视区域时才进行加载。通过懒加载,页面的初次渲染可以更快完成,减少了不必要的资源请求,从而提高了用户体验。

页面缓存与性能优化

另一个能够有效减少视觉回流的技术是缓存策略。在91网页版中,可以通过缓存页面的静态资源和用户的浏览历史记录,避免每次加载时都重新请求资源。缓存不仅可以显著提升页面的加载速度,还能减少由于频繁请求服务器导致的性能瓶颈。

通过合理的缓存策略,开发者可以确保用户在浏览网页时不需要重复加载相同的资源,从而减少回流的发生,并提高页面响应速度。例如,在社交平台中,缓存用户的聊天记录和历史页面内容,可以避免用户每次访问时都从服务器重新加载数据,从而减少页面渲染的开销。

91网页版的视觉回流研究是提升用户体验、优化网页性能的重要课题。通过有效的页面跳转优化、历史记录管理、预加载策略和缓存优化,开发者能够减少视觉回流现象的发生,提高页面的响应速度和用户的浏览体验。随着技术的不断进步,未来网页应用将更加智能和高效,带给用户更加流畅和舒适的使用感受。